Who has done this? ,  I buy  a couple of knives and then later on see a special one I want , but I have already blown the budget buying the other knives, and  I think, hey if I had not bought five $ 20 knives I could have bought the $100 one I just found ! I do agree with what Tobias said  about research and patience, I have bought a knife on Ebay for say $23 and later on the knife went for $36-$40. The people who bought the knife at the $ 40 price could have saved some money if they had been watching the market. Granted the knives would have to be of equal condition, but the ones I have seen sell higher than what  I paid were not in as good a condition.

I started by buying on impulse...most of those knives have been traded or sold at a monetary loss to me. Trial and error, what I bought then is probably now the jewel of someone else's user rotation. I don't regret buying those knives, I learned from those experiences and someone got a decent knife to use below MSRP.
